Foster Farms has been a family-owned and operated company for four generations. Since our founding days back in 1939, we have always been committed to providing consumers with the highest-quality, best-tasting poultry products available. The hope is that our commitment to excellence, honesty, quality, service, and our people will shine through in everything we do.

We are always looking for talented individuals to join the Foster Farms team. We offer the experience of a large organization, but operate like a family business. More than half of our job openings are filled by internal promotion, and we encourage employees to gain a variety of experiences across different functional groups.

PURPOSE OF POSITION:

This position is responsible within the Enterprise Computing Platforms functions for the:

  1. Baseline support and enhancement; including monitoring, maintenance, support, improvement and integration of assigned server, operating systems, and infrastructure-based products (Infrastructure Functions) in the Foster Farms computing environment.
  2. Solution recommendation, selection (for SE II and II) and implementation of new vendor-supplied and/or in-house developed software, hardware, and operating system, (Infrastructure Solutions) within assigned Infrastructure Functions.

The System Engineer I (SE I) will work closely with IT staff to provide effective and efficient business solutions in the assigned Infrastructure Functions. This position will monitor and analyze assigned Infrastructure Solutions to determine the efficiency and effectiveness of the Foster Farms Infrastructure environment. This requires a limited degree of creativity and latitude.

The SE I may also play a role enforcing standards relating to the use of assigned Infrastructure Functions.

The System Engineer II and System Engineer III (SE II and SE III) will work closely with IT staff and end users to provide effective and efficient business solutions in the assigned Infrastructure Functions. This position will monitor and analyze assigned Infrastructure Solutions to determine the optimum configuration and design of the Foster Farms Infrastructure environment. This requires a certain degree of creativity and latitude.

The SE II or III may also play a role in establishing and enforcing standards relating to the use of assigned Infrastructure Functions.
